History

"I've lived a long time, sure you wanna hear it all, mate?"

Jack's history extends over 52 years, carrying with it personal tragedy and guilt, but hopefully some dry, snarky laughs and adventures. It's what he wakes up for after all. From rebellious teenager, to adventurous adult, to responsible demon hunter.

Origins

"I didn't have any defining tragedy, if that's what you're asking mate... If anything, my family was fairly stable."

It's true, Pembrook's family was loving and affectionate in the Welsh town of Swansea. He was born in 1961 at Morriston Hospital to two loving parents. Their firstborn son, he encountered minor health complications at his birth, these complications were miraculously healed from him in the middle of the night, a bright light supposedly filling the room and curing him of his ailments. To this day, his parents believe this to be an act of divine intervention by the Christian God himself, the experience converting the two parents into devout, loving Christians.

Early life

Jack's home life was, while loving and tender, very boring. At least in his eyes, from a young age he liked to act out and adventure, causing mayhem for his parents but fun for him. This attitude continued into his teenage years, resulting in a long rebellious streak, leading him to several run-ins with the police, breaking his parents hearts and exposure to a world of drugs and vices. It was, coincidentally, this vice-filled lifestyle that drove the young lad down the path he follows today, as an altruistic demon hunter. Throughout his teenage years, he was educated at the Bishop Vaughan Catholic School - the experience still failing to convert him into a devout religious follower like his parents, only pushing him further away from their moral beliefs. He dropped out of school without passing his A-Level exams, leaving his qualifications rather... Lacklustre.

One night, just after his seventeenth birthday, Jack was bound to an underground rave alongside some friend outside of school, successfully evading his parents - for years, they would have no idea what happened that night.

Discovering magic

The rave was everything Jack wanted it to be, loud music, attractive women, drugs and alcohol - a dream for a rebellious youth. That was until the newest Metal band on the scene came out. The music began playing, everyone dancing, but then the most curious things started to happen - Jack's vision began failing, stretching and blurring, until the artists on stage appeared... Demonic, the music sounding like tortured screams. He sought to block it out, covering his ears and shifting out of the mosh pits, to the back of the warehouse. The was a woman there too, not much older than him, clutching her ears tightly, all whilst glaring at the act on stage. She noticed Jack suffering from the same phenomena, glancing at him curiously.

The world changed for Jack at that moment, the artists on stage apparently abandoning their thin veneer between human and demon, assuming demonic personas, the music turning to ear-bursting screams for everyone, crippling many of the crowd and forcing them to their knees. The woman beside him stepping forward, her hand glowing brightly - Jack didn't know, but could feel the ethereal energies flowing from it. She flung the energy towards the act on stage, a planar fracture opening up - sending the demons right back to Hell. The supernatural display both frightening and eliciting awe from the young lad. He blinked for a moment, as though to take in what he had just seen. The woman was gone. He fled the scene soon after that, leaving his injured friends behind in a hurry.

Appearance

When in human form, Jack's attire is fairly straightforward and predictable:

He'll usually be seen wearing his dark brown, leather trench coat and white shirt, with a varying colour tie depending on his mood. The trench coat is usually buttoned up, concealing most of his body and adding, in his opinion, a layer of mystery to him. It might make him appear generic as an Occult investigator, but his coat provides practical benefits alongside keeping him warm. Occasionally, he'll wear the trench coat down, letting it flow behind him. Other times, he'll ditch the trench coat, and roll up his sleeves on his shirt, usually when engrossed in work at the Sanctum.

Physically, Jack appears to be a male of about twenty-seven years old, a stubble worn across his face proudly, adding to his rugged, dark haired appearance. His build is athletic rather than muscular, showing his attempts to stay in shape. He stands tall at about Six foot, deep green eyes being a notable feature to those that stare too long; I suppose it's ironic, given his penchant for jealousy.

When in his demonic form, his attire is even more simple:

Eleoin wears whatever clothes Jack was wearing, they are, however, torn and ripped given the increase in muscle density and height.

Physically, Eleoin is of approximately 7 feet tall, with horns protruding from his forehead and left shoulder, his skin charcoal grey. He has terrifying glowing red eyes, fitting a stereotypically demonic description, his body is covered in bulging muscles, betraying his immense strength. His extremities end in sharp, vicious looking claws, occasionally seen dripping with some form of liquid.

Personality

Jack Pembrook is a very world-wizened man. He's seen a lot in his time which has gradually diminished his personality and withered him down to bare basics. He's cynical at times and prone to dry, sarcastic humour as a method of dealing with his personal issues and shrugging off the responsibilities and dangers he finds himself facing off every day - at the expense of seeming cold and aloof, annoying many heroes he's met in his life. He's a passionate man, caring deeply about those close to him, to the point of being willing to do anything in order to save them. That being said, he does also have a selfish streak, born of a determination to save his soul from Hell, an almost impossible feat due to his weak-willed addiction to various vices. He's ultimately an indifferent realist, very little surprising him and always maintaining a fair, reasoned view of the world - allowing neither optimism or pessimism to pull him too far. He's also largely manipulative to those he deems beneath him or wasting his time, playing them to his own means. His harsh life experiences have left him with a somewhat broken moral compass, being neither a white knight or an evil person - but rather walking the faint line between the two.

He also bares a deep, vengeful streak. Those that wrong him need to beware of his wrath, for he stops at nothing to attain his revenge, either through macabre methods or manipulative means - bearing the traits of a sociopath at times when pursuing a vendetta.

He's also known to possess an annoying jealous streak at times. Rather ironic given his green eyes, fitting the old term "Green-eyed with jealousy".

With regards to forming relationships, Pembrook shies away from forming lasting and important bonds, under the belief that those around him tend to end up dead, or worse. This leaves his romantic life rather stunted, frequently unable to reciprocate real feelings, or backing away from them in an attempt to protect those he's with. His relationships are usually superficial sex in that respect, something he has finally managed to break free of in finding an immortal relationship in the vampire Mephisto, showing a good form of improvement for the largely romantically insecure man.

Jack's personality is the result of trauma through his life, his rebellious streak born of a desire to reject his parents' stern and heavily religious upbringing by any means necessary, even if, in many cases, it led him to doing things he didn't actually want to do. These experienced shaped him into an untrusting and insecure cynic who routinely avoided forming real bonds, seeing people as pawns to use rather than genuine beings to form relationships with. Maybe he'll get better... Only time will tell.
